Long-term health conditions and the need for help with everyday activities.
Mental health conditions are the most common long-term health issue in postcode 3140, where 10.7% of people live with such a condition. This reflects a broader trend in the area, as residents are far more likely to have a long-term health problem than people across Victoria or Australia.
Long-term conditions people report.
About 32.4% of people here have a long-term health condition, which is well above the national figure of 27.7%. Beyond mental health, the most frequent issues reported are arthritis at 10.3% and asthma at 10.0%.

People needing help with daily activities.
Six point two percent of residents need help with daily activities, which is higher than in most other areas. This figure has risen by 2.4 percentage points since 2011.
